Obama's comments came on the same day that the Democratic chairman of the Senate Banking Committee threatened to bring before his committee any Wall Street executives who take big bonuses after their firms are propped up with public money.

"Whether it was used directly or indirectly, this infuriates the American people and rightly so," said Sen. Christopher J. Dodd (http://projects.washingtonpost.com/congress/members/d000388) (D-Conn.). "So I say to anyone else who does it: If you do it, I'm going to bring you before the committee." This is the same Dodd who not very long ago:

Senators Christopher Dodd (D-Conn.) and Kent Conrad (D-N.D.) have been implicated in a mortgage scandal involving Countrywide bank. This is obviously a touchy issue considering that Dodd is the chairman of the Senate banking committee, it is an election year and a $300 billion lender bailout is supposed to be voted on today in the Senate.
